Using the Composite Connections 
NOTE: If the device has an S-Video connector it is recommended to use the S-Video connection described 
earlier in this section for better picture quality. 
 
1.  Prepare the audio and composite video cables (supplied) for this connection. 
2.  Connect one end of the composite video cable (yellow) to the composite video connector 
(yellow) at the AV1/AV2 locations on the LCD TV. Connect the other end to the 
corresponding composite video connector (yellow) of the device. 
3.  Connect the R (red) and L (white) audio cable ends to the L-Audio-R connectors at the 
AV1/AV2 locations on the LCD TV. Connect the other ends to the corresponding left and 
right audio connectors (red and white) of the device. 
 
4.  To use the connected device, turn on your LCD TV, press the 
SOURCE
 button to open the 
Main Source menu, press T to scroll through the source list and select AV1 or AV2 as the 
input source. Press 
ENTER
 to confirm AV1 or AV2 as your selection. 
5.  Turn on the device. 
NOTE: For more information, see the instructions supplied with the video/audio recording device.
